Federal Way Head Start
Federal Way, WA

As part of a Federal Way youth and education complex, this Head Start Child Care Center is sited to allow for both intimate courtyard spaces and secure outdoor play areas on a busy campus. Cascade Design Collaborative developed the overall site design for the larger campus in addition to the landscape design of this Head Start facility. Using the Reggio Emilia concept of hands-on, art-based learning, the Child Care Center design provides flexibility and encourages interaction among the children and teachers. Students from the adjacent Truman Alternative High School utilize the Center as well.

Outdoor play spaces are filled with elements that provide opportunities for children to explore their natural environment. The design includes a hand pump for water play, tree fort, tricycle track, play deck, raised stage, garden plots and a large, low-branching tree for climbing. Plants such as lavender, rosemary and ornamental grasses stimulate the senses and add color. A community garden is located adjacent to the children’s play area.
